Oriel Reference Cell and Meter The Oriel® Reference Cell, which is an integral part of solar simulator calibration and solar cell I-V characterization, consists of a readout device and a 2 x 2 cm calibrated solar cell made of monocrystaline silicon. In addition, there''s a separate performance warranty on solar cells provided by solar cells manufacturers. Most manufacturers of solar cells used on the solar panels provide the standard industry warranty, which is that solar cells are guaranteed to produce at least 90% of nominal power in 10 years and 80% of nominal power in 25 years.
